What We Do

SSO’s unique resiliency and spiritual fitness program equips active-duty service members with the tools to enhance physical, mental, and spiritual fitness, making them mission ready, combat effective, and prepared for challenges on and off the battlefield.

Through activities like rock climbing, skydiving, whitewater rafting, and more, SSO engages participants in events purposefully intended to push them out of their comfort zone. Faith-based discussions led by fellow service members or veterans explore identity and the impact of a strong spiritual foundation on overall fitness.

Participants return to their commands as stronger individuals and team members, boosting unit cohesion and readiness.

Who We Serve

SSO’s program is 100% active-duty military focused and is provided at no cost to the government or the service member. Our program aligns with Department of Defense goals for building resiliency, spiritual fitness, and unit readiness by making the requirements for mental, spiritual, physical, emotional, and social fitness practical and engaging, moving beyond the classroom.

From Joshua Tree National Park to the coast of California, the Rocky Mountains, or along the East Coast, every SSO outdoor adventure program takes place in the backdrop that is God’s creation.

Nearly 20,000 Active Duty Military Service Members Have Attended Our Program Since 2014
